0

我准备的 JS 包(使用 tsdx)正在多个公司系统中使用。它位于我们的 gitlab 中,因此 package.json 条目如下所示:

"some-package": "git+ssh://git@gitlab.company.com:some-place/some-package.git#some-branch"

现在,每次用户执行此操作时,npm install都需要花费大量时间才能完成该过程。是因为我推送 src/ 文件夹而不是 dist/ (我这样做)?包每次被下载时都会自行构建npm install吗?我应该推送 dist/ 文件夹以缩短完成所需的时间npm install吗?

4

1 回答 1

0

Npm install 正在下载您的所有依赖项并将它们放在 node_modules 文件夹中。

dist 文件夹通常用于您构建的应用程序,因此提交和推送 dist 文件夹对处理时间没有帮助。

于 2020-10-06T12:57:37.723 回答